The Benefits of Canopy Cutaway Systems in Base Jumping Parachutes
Base jumping is an exhilarating extreme sport where individuals leap off fixed objects, using parachutes to safely descend. One essential component of these parachutes is the canopy cutaway system. This system is designed to enhance safety and performance during jumps. In a situation where the main canopy malfunctions, the cutaway feature allows the jumper to detach from the faulty parachute, providing the opportunity to deploy a reserve canopy. The design ingeniously utilizes various mechanisms such as pull-down flaps that enable quick detachment. The advantage of having this safety feature significantly boosts the confidence of the jumper, knowing they possess a backup system for emergencies. Furthermore, this system is particularly beneficial in high-risk jumps where the potential for malfunctions is increased. Not only does this feature provide a sense of security, but it also fosters the opportunity for more adventurous stunts, allowing jumpers to push their limits while minimizing the risks involved. Thus, the canopy cutaway system forms an integral part of modern base jumping gear, contributing to improved safety standards in the sport.
Enhanced Safety During Jumps
The implementation of the canopy cutaway system significantly enhances the safety of base jumpers. Traditional parachute systems utilized by jumpers often faced risks associated with malfunctioning main canopies, leading to severe accidents. By incorporating a cutaway system into the design, jumpers can act quickly in emergencies. When a main canopy gets entangled or does not inflate properly, a cutaway allows the jumper to disconnect from the main parachute. This allows for a safer reserve deployment. The efficiency of this system is crucial, particularly when altitude is low and time is limited. Moreover, the reassurance of having a functioning reserve lets jumpers focus on their technique and overall enjoyment of the sport.
